Frequently Asked Questions

Here we are trying to answer some of the questions that our Ordeal Candidates might have prior to their Ordeal. If you have a question that we have not answered here, please e-mail our Inductions team. They will be glad to help in any way they can.

Should I pay for my Ordeal in advance?

We prefer that you register online and pay at that time. This allows us to better plan for those that will be attending.

How much does it cost to attend the Ordeal?

The cost of the Ordeal for Candidates is $45.00. This includes all of the meals on Saturday and breakfast on Sunday. Please eat well before you arrive on Friday. There is no dinner served that night.

Should I register in advance?

Yes, by all means. This makes it easier for us to plan out your meals and supplies.

When should I arrive for the Ordeal?

You should arrive for the Ordeal between 6:00pm to 8:00pm on Friday evening.

When is the Ordeal over?

The Ordeal is over on Sunday morning. If you need to leave Saturday night typically around 8pm the events are completed.

I’m under 18. If I forget my medical form is that OK?

NO! You will not be allowed to participate in the Ordeal if you do not have a medical form that is signed by your parent. Here you can get a medical form.

I’m over 21, do I still need a medical form?

Yes, however, you won’t need to get your grownups to sign it.

Packing List

  • First aid kit
  • Knife *very important!
  • Seasonal work clothes
  • Gloves
  • Sleeping bag
  • Ground cloth
  • Flashlight
  • Toiletries
  • Rain gear
  • Sun Screen
  • Bug Spray
  • Water Bottle
  • Official Scout Uniform (Class A)

What kind of stuff should I NOT bring?

  • Food
  • Radios
  • Phones
  • Guns
  • Video games
  • Fireworks 


Do I need to bring any money to the Ordeal?

All meals are included in the cost of the Ordeal. However, after you have completed your Ordeal, there is a Trading Post that will be open.  They have stuff like patches, assorted OA items, snacks, and pops.
